### Alert: ProctorQueue backlog over threshold

Heads up: this fires when the Invigilo exam-proctoring queue holds more than 500 unclaimed sessions for 10 minutes. Usually it means the reviewer pool autoscaler in the Hallway service got stuck, not that students are flooding in. Check the autoscaler logs first — nine times out of ten a restart clears it. If sessions are actually timing out, that's exam-impacting, so escalate fast. Questions about tuning the threshold go to the address below.

escalation mailbox, yafog-kafof: eliok@xolmarcloud.local

The Pellworth resizer's throughput depends heavily on worker count and chunk sizing, and the defaults were chosen for a mid-range eight-core box. Future maintainers should resist raising concurrency blindly: past a point, decode memory dominates and the process gets OOM-killed on large TIFF batches. Benchmark on representative inputs before changing anything. For reference, the constants shipped in the current build are the following.

limits module of tafop-hahop:
WEIGHTS = {
    "julmir": 223,
    "belox": 987,
    "lamion": 470,
    "pelath": 609,
    "fraok": 1010,
    "eliion": 343,
    "drudor": 342,
}

### Changed defaults

Upgrading Quillbus from 4.x to 5.0 changes several broker defaults: acknowledgements are now explicit, the prefetch count dropped from 250 to 50, and queues are durable unless declared otherwise. Consumers relying on implicit acks must be patched before rollout. The 5.0 client is backward compatible at the wire level, so mixed fleets are fine during migration. The revised broker defaults are listed below.

deployment values, yadug-bawif:
[framir]
team = pelox
access_code = ac_a38ab2
owner = tamion.julael
host = framir.tolvaqlabs.test
port = 11211
peer = tammir.zemvargrid.local
salt = 2215ef03
pin = 1541